CppSerdes  1.0
A serialization/deserialization library designed with embedded systems in mind
serdes::packet_base Member List

This is the complete list of members for serdes::packet_base, including all inherited members.

format(packet &)=0serdes::packet_basepure virtual
load(const T_array(&source_buffer)[N], size_t max_elements=N, size_t bit_offset=0)serdes::packet_base
load(const T_pointer source_buffer, size_t max_elements=~size_t(0), size_t bit_offset=0)serdes::packet_base
load(const T_sized_pointer source_buffer, size_t bit_offset=0)serdes::packet_base
load(const T_array(&source_buffer)[N], size_t max_elements, size_t bit_offset) (defined in serdes::packet_base)serdes::packet_base
load(const T_pointer source_buffer, size_t max_elements, size_t bit_offset) (defined in serdes::packet_base)serdes::packet_base
load(const T_sized_pointer target_buffer, size_t bit_offset) (defined in serdes::packet_base)serdes::packet_base
operator<<(T &&value)serdes::packet_base
operator<<(T &&value) (defined in serdes::packet_base)serdes::packet_base
operator>>(T &&value)serdes::packet_base
operator>>(T &&value) (defined in serdes::packet_base)serdes::packet_base
store(T_array(&target_buffer)[N], size_t max_elements=N, size_t bit_offset=0)serdes::packet_base
store(T_pointer target_buffer, size_t max_elements=~size_t(0), size_t bit_offset=0)serdes::packet_base
store(T_sized_pointer target_buffer, size_t bit_offset=0)serdes::packet_base
store(T_array(&target_buffer)[N], size_t max_elements, size_t bit_offset) (defined in serdes::packet_base)serdes::packet_base
store(T_pointer target_buffer, size_t max_elements, size_t bit_offset) (defined in serdes::packet_base)serdes::packet_base
store(T_sized_pointer target_buffer, size_t bit_offset) (defined in serdes::packet_base)serdes::packet_base
~packet_base()=default (defined in serdes::packet_base)serdes::packet_basevirtual